    Itinerary

    Collapse all Expand all

    Day 1

    Arrive Auckland

    On arrival into Auckland, be met at the airport and transferred to your hotel. Enjoy the rest of the day at leisure.

    Stay: Auckland, Sudima Hotel Auckland City

    Day 2

    Auckland, Bay of Islands

    Signature Experience: Visit the Waitangi Treaty Grounds, where the original treaty between the British and Maori people was signed.

    Cross Auckland’s Harbour Bridge and travel along the Hibiscus Coast. Stop at Matakohe’s Kauri Museum for an insight into the rich pioneering history of the Northland region. Continue to the Bay of Islands where you will enjoy a visit to the Maori Meeting House and War Canoe at Waitangi Treaty Grounds.

    Stay: Two Nights, Bay of Islands, Copthorne Hotel and Resort

    Day 3

    Bay of Islands

    Meander through the Bay of Islands and keep watch for marine life, then spend some time in a secluded bay.

    Explore the Bay of Islands on a catamaran cruise to Cape Brett and the famous Hole in the Rock.

    Day 4

    Bay of Islands, Auckland

    Freedom of Choice™ – Sightseeing: Perhaps cruise on Waitemata Harbour; enjoy a unique All Blacks experience; visit Auckland Zoo to discover the native flora and fauna of New Zealand; or immerse yourself in a Make Believe Experience and journey behind the cinema curtain with the Academy Award-winning team at Weta Workshop; or escape the bustle of the city on a tour to Auckland’s wild, black sand beaches and lush rainforest.

    Travel to Auckland and take in the city sights before selecting from our Freedom of Choice activities. Back at your hotel this evening, enjoy a delicious Pacific-themed dinner.

    Stay: Auckland, Sudima Hotel Auckland City

    Day 5

    Auckland, Waitomo Caves, Rotorua

    Signature Experience: Immerse yourself in Māori culture as you enjoy a traditional Hāngī Feast and performance of song and dance.

    Travel to Waitomo, home to the famous glow worm caves where thousands of tiny luminescent creatures radiate an eerie glow. Discover this natural wonder on a guided tour, before continuing to Rotorua.

    Stay: Two Nights, Millennium Rotorua

    Day 6

    Rotorua

    Freedom of Choice™ – Sightseeing: Perhaps enjoy a sheep show at the Agrodome followed by a visit to Te Puia Thermal Reserve. Alternatively, choose to visit Wai-O-Tapu or experience Middle-earth during a tour of the Hobbiton Movie Set.

    Spend this morning on your Freedom of Choice activity. Afterwards, the afternoon and evening are free for you to explore.

    Day 7

    Rotorua, Taupo, Wellington

    Follow the Thermal Explorer Highway to the heart of New Zealand’s North Island this morning. View the Wairakei Steam Valley, then visit Huka Falls and Lake Taupo, before travelling across the plateau of Tongariro National Park to Wellington.

    Stay: Two Nights, InterContinental Wellington

    Day 8

    Wellington

    After breakfast, set off on a sightseeing tour of Wellington’s best-loved landmarks and sights, including the waterfront area and New Zealand’s national museum – Te Papa Tongarewa. The rest of the day will be yours at leisure to further explore this coastal city and perhaps dine at a local restaurant.

    Day 9

    Wellington, Christchurch

    Signature Experience: This morning, step aboard the Interislander ferry to cruise across Cook Strait and through the stunning waters of Marlborough and Queen Charlotte sounds to Picton.

    Arrive on the South Island and travel to the quaint fishing town of Kaikoura before continuing along the central east coast all the way to Christchurch.

    Stay: Christchurch, Commodore Hotel

    Day 10

    Christchurch, TranzAlpine Train, Franz Josef

    Signature Experience: Board the TranzAlpine train for one of the world’s greatest rail adventures.

    Signature Experience: Take in the dramatic surrounds of the Franz Josef Glacier.

    Pass through epic river valleys and past awesome mountain ranges then disembark at Arthur’s Pass and travel to Hokitika, where you will see pounamu (jade) being carved into pieces of jewellery. Continue to Franz Josef.

    Stay: Scenic Hotel Franz Josef Glacier (or similar)

    Day 11

    Franz Josef, Queenstown

    Freedom of Choice™ – Dining: On a Freedom of Choice Dining evening perhaps sample quality crafted beer at Canyon Food & Brew Co. Alternatively, take a scenic gondola ride to the Skyline Restaurant for dinner with a view. You may prefer a cruise aboard the TSS Earnslaw, a vintage steamboat, or dine amid the stylish surrounds of the Elements Restaurant.

    Enjoy a day of breathtaking scenery as you travel to Queenstown.

    Stay: Two Nights, Novotel Queenstown Lakeside

    Day 12

    Queenstown

    Freedom of Choice™ – Sightseeing: Perhaps visit several local sites where The Lord of the Rings trilogy was filmed. Alternatively, set out on a Skippers Canyon adventure or a river safari along the beautiful Dart River. A tour of the country’s premier wine-producing region is a tempting option, or a leisurely cruise over the waters of Lake Wakatipu.

    Enjoy the flexibility of how to spend your morning with a range of Freedom of Choice activities on offer.

    Day 13

    Queenstown, Milford Sound, Te Anau

    Signature Experience: Enjoy a cruise that explores the full length of the pristine fiord which is Milford Sound.

    Signature Experience: Tonight, enjoy a Taste of Fiordland Dinner, and savour local delights such as salmon and lamb.

    Embark on one of the most scenic drives today as you journey along the Milford Road and into the heart of Fiordland National Park. Wind down the Eglinton and Hollyford valleys, then drive through the Homer Tunnel to be met by the sight of Mitre Peak, the iconic backdrop to Milford Sound. Continue to Milford Sound. Afterwards, enjoy a picturesque drive to the lakeside settlement of Te Anau.

    Stay: Distinction Luxmore Hotel

    Day 14

    Te Anau, Dunedin

    Freedom of Choice™ – Sightseeing: Perhaps visit Olveston Historic Home, or discover the history of Larnach Castle, nestled on the stunning Otago Peninsula. Those who enjoy a beer may choose to visit Speight’s Brewery for a tasting.

    Journey through Southland countryside as you travel to Dunedin, a city known as the ‘Edinburgh of the South’. This afternoon, choose your Freedom of Choice activity.

    Stay: Distinction Dunedin Hotel

    Day 15

    Dunedin, Aoraki Mt Cook

    Signature Experience: Visit Aoraki Mt Cook National Park to see New Zealand’s highest mountain.

    Freedom of Choice™ – Sightseeing: Visit the Sir Edmund Hillary Alpine Centre, or the planetarium for a stargazing session. Alternatively, during the summer months, board a MAC boat and get up close to icebergs on the Tasman Glacier Terminal Lake.

    Drive north and stop to view the Moeraki Boulders on Koekohe Beach. Continue to Aoraki Mt Cook National Park, where you choose your activity.

    Stay: Aoraki Mt Cook, The Hermitage Hotel, in a room with alpine views

    Day 16

    Aoraki Mt Cook, Lake Tekapo, Christchurch

    Travel to Lake Tekapo and pay a visit to the tiny Church of the Good Shepherd. Enjoy a Farewell Dinner at your hotel.

    Stay: Rydges Latimer Christchurch

    Day 17

    Depart Christchurch

    Today you will be transferred to the airport for your flight home.
